Business Funds
Businesses that are eligible for the neighborhood matching funds program, established in Seattle, have to meet certain criteria. Check at http://www.seattle.gov/neighborhoods/nmf/ to find out more about the possibility of getting funds for your business. Usually, the project has to have a community-focus that enriches the neighborhood to be eligible for consideration.
Don’t forget to check out the local Small Business Administration office in Seattle too. Check out 7a loans with them. Seattle has a keen interest in developing their port more, so if your business can be shown to improve that area, you can also get loans based on that criteria through Seattle’s port improvement programs.
Non-Profits
There are many programs for non-profits in Seattle. There are multiple opportunities to get a non-profit funded in Seattle, no matter what the size. If you only have a great community idea, but feel you’d never be able to get started without some funds, check out what’s available in Seattle. For people who are in between jobs, or not eager to start a for-profit company, the non-profit niche can help them give back to the community as a second career choice. The Seattle Foundation located at http://www.seattlefoundation.org offers grants to non-profits for capital expenses, equipment, and/or operating costs. It is a competitive program, but a great way to get started in a noble cause in Seattle.
Technology Investment
Any projects that help part of the city’s community that have not reached their technological potential are considered for technology grants. The program is called the Bill Wright Technology Matching Fund.
